FESTIVAL PROGRAMMERS
All “Festival Programmers” will be interviewed at least once by the Director of RIFFA and/or Head of Programming In-Competition films, and they must meet at least one of the following requirements:
1. Completed formal education (diploma, associate degree, degree) in a film or media related field of study
2. At least 3 years of experience in the role of screener, programming associate or programmer with a formally established film festival
3. At least 3 years proven experience in film/art curation/film distribution/script reading and other related experiences
4. Film criticism work, with an active membership with a national/provincial critics association, with 3 years of published work.
FESTIVAL PROGRAMMING ASSOCIATES
All “Festival Programming Associates” will be interviewed at least once by the Director of RIFFAand/ or Head of Programming In-Competition films, and must meet at least one of the following requirements:
1. Students enrolled in a film or media related diploma/degree program
2. Entry-level film critics with at least 1 year of published work
3. Self-taught filmmakers/creative professionals with filmmaking experience and solid insight into the art of cinema and curation
The Head of Programming will decide if a volunteer’s past level of experience qualifies them for a Programmer or Programming Associate position.
